The St. Martin Parish Council voted April 7 to award the contract for the new Parks branch library to apparent low bidder Chart Construction, LLC, in the amount of $998,744, following a recommendation from Angelle Architects. The Council authorized the Parish President and the designee of the Library Board of Control to execute contract documents.
In personnel actions, the council appointed Mr. Brandon Miller to fill the unexpired term of Kirk Taylor on the St. Martin Parish Planning Commission representing District 8 (term expires June 14, 2026), and Mr. Christopher Hollier to fill the unexpired term of Jonathan Gregory representing District 7 (term expires April 3, 2028). Both appointments were adopted unanimously.
The Council also accepted a donation from the St. Martin Parish Library Board of Control of two computers to be housed at the Cade Community Center for outreach; Cajun Broadband agreed to provide internet service for the machines at no cost. The Parish President was authorized to accept the donation and enter into an intergovernmental agreement to implement the arrangement.
Council members thanked library leadership for the project and noted the Cade Community Center resource improvements. The items passed by unanimous vote; minutes record no public opposition.
